Additional Information on Eligibility: This financial assistance opportunity is also open to all partners under any Cooperative Ecosystem Studies Unit (CESU) program. CESUs are partnerships that provide research, technical assistance, and education. If a cooperative agreement is awarded to a CESU partner under a formally negotiated Master CESU agreement, indirect costs are limited to a rate of no more than 17.5% of the indirect cost base recognized in the partner’s Federal Agency-approved Negotiated Indirect Cost Rate Agreement.

Agency Name: Bureau of Land Management
Description: In California, the BLM has worked with stakeholders to share information and technical expertise, which assists managing native plant communities and native plant species on public lands including botanical inventories population and genetic studies, demographic and life history studies, habitat modeling, vulnerability assessments of plants and plant communities to changes in temperature and precipitation, development and implement tools, monitoring plans, restoration and management plans, assess restoration efforts that improve the management and understanding of rare and common plant species. BLM has reviewed models and research products and plans as they are developed, and facilitated seed collections and access to public lands that further research investigations and studies.

The National Seed Strategy for Rehabilitation and Restoration provides goals and objectives for the development of genetically appropriate native seed for the rehabilitation and restoration of public lands.

There is a need to implement this strategy in California, to further improve ecosystem health, provide adaptation to climate change, and native plant communities and wildlife habitat restoration and management objectives.
